Common issues for Kias in our area include engine problems related to the Theta II engines (requiring recall checks), brake wear from frequent stop-and-go driving on M-52, and suspension components stressed by Michigan potholes. Winter road salt also accelerates corrosion on exhaust systems and undercarriage components, making regular undercarriage washes crucial.
Look for shops in Pleasant Lake or nearby Jackson that are Kia-certified or have technicians with specific Kia training, as they will have the proper diagnostic software (like GDS). Check reviews for local shops mentioning Kia models, and confirm they use OEM or high-quality aftermarket parts to ensure compatibility with your vehicle's systems.
Seek a local independent specialist for out-of-warranty repairs, recall completion if the dealership is backlogged, or for a second opinion on a major diagnosis. For complex warranty or software-related issues, the dealership's direct access to Kia technical support may still be necessary.

Given our rural roads, seasonal temperature extremes, and harsh winters, adhere to the "severe service" schedule in your Kia manual. This means more frequent oil changes (especially with short trips), earlier brake inspections, and vigilant tire rotations to combat uneven wear from gravel roads and potholes.
